# Streets of Chaos - Parent Guide Streets of Chaos is a turn-based strategy game set in a zombie post-apocalypse with mild violence and no profanity or sexual content. The tactical, board game-like gameplay is straightforward and single-player only. It's generally appropriate for most children, though the zombie theme and mild horror elements may concern parents of younger or more sensitive children.
